I haven't bought any ebooks. I have read some that were available for free and some that I received as review copies, and I feel there's a lack of quality control in the industry as a whole. Reputable publishers put out quality material, but vanity publishers and self-publishing efforts often sell sub-standard products. I am especially wary of ebooks on topics relating to making money online, whether marketing or selling articles or any other work-from-home plan, because I've seen too many such books that were put out by people who had essentially failed in the subject matter they claim to teach and turned to selling hope to the unwary instead. And those books, in my limited experience, often turn out to be nothing more than a collection of blog posts or other freely available materials, repackaged for sale.

Note: Obviously I'm talking about ebook-only products here, not books that are published in both ebook and print formats. I've purchased a lot of those. My Nook has saved me from buying at least two more bookshelves for my office.
